ORDER
This writ petition has been filed for the issuance of Writ of Certiorari, calling for the records from the second respondent pursuant to his proceedings No.H.O.Ref.No.11(5)/Estt./2011/3725 dated 04.10.2013 leading to the appointment of 9th Respondent to the post of DDTD (P) with effect from 7th October 2013 and quash the same in the substantial interest of equity, fairness.
2. When the matter was listed for hearing on 06.12.2024, this Court passed the following order:- " The learned Standing Counsel appearing for the respondents 1 to 8 submits that the petitioner had filed this writ petition challenging the appointment of the 9th respondent as a Deputy Director. He further submits that the petitioner who was an in-service candidate challenged the promotion of the 9th respondent, only on the ground that he was ought to promoted to the post of Deputy Director.
2. It is also submitted that pursuant to the filing of writ petition, the petitioner was also promoted to the post of Deputy Director and the petitioner is no more. Therefore, the issues sought for in this writ petition become infructuous.
3. When this writ petition was listed on 30.10.2024, there was no representation on behalf of the petitioner. Today also, there is no representation on
behalf of the petitioner.
4. Post the matter on 11.12.2024, under the caption "For Dismissal".
3. Even today, there is no representation on the side of the petitioner. Accordingly, this writ petition is dismissed for non prosecution. No costs.
